Dr. Qinghua Yu is a leading researcher in the field of soft robotics and smart materials, with a particular focus on light-responsive soft actuators. Their work centers on developing flexible, biologically inspired robots that can adapt to their environments, offering significant advantages over traditional rigid robots in terms of human-computer interaction and adaptability. Dr. Yu’s major contributions include pioneering the design of carbon-based photo-thermal responsive film actuators featuring a novel sandwich structure. This innovation, detailed in their highly cited 2021 work, utilizes low-cost Ketjen Black to create actuators that are simple to fabricate yet deliver exceptional performance, enabling precise wireless remote control through light. Their comprehensive 2021 review on light-responsive soft actuators, which has garnered 47 citations, systematically explores the mechanisms, materials, and applications in this rapidly advancing field.
